Abstract:
Knowledge of the mass function in open clusters constitutes one way to
constrain the formation of low-mass stars and brown dwarfs along with
the knowledge of the frequency of multiple systems and the properties
of disks.
The aim of the project is to determine the shape of the mass function
in the low-mass and substellar regimes in the pre-main sequence
(27Myr) cluster IC4665 located at 350pc from the Sun.
We have cross-matched the near-infrared photometric data from the
Eighth Data Release (DR8) of the UKIRT Infrared Deep Sky Survey
(UKIDSS) Galactic Clusters Survey (GCS) with previous optical data
obtained with the Canada-France-Hawaii (CFH) wide-field camera to
improve the determination of the luminosity and mass functions in
the low-mass and substellar regimes. The availability of i and z
photometry taken with the CFH12K camera on the Canada France Hawaii
Telescope added strong constraints to the UKIDSS photometric selection
in this cluster located in a dense region of our Galaxy.
We have derived the luminosity and mass functions of the cluster
down to J=18.5mag, corresponding to masses of ∼0.025M☉ at
the distance and age of IC4665 according to theoretical models. In
addition, we have extracted new candidate members down to ∼20 Jupiter
masses in a previously unstudied region of the cluster. We have
derived the mass function over the 0.6-0.04M☉ mass range and
found that it is best represented by a log-normal function with a peak
at 0.25-0.16M☉, consistent with the determination in the
Pleiades.
